English Definitions:
brace, suspender, gallus (noun)
elastic straps that hold trousers up (usually used in the plural)
suspender (Noun)
Something or someone who suspends.
suspender (Noun)
An item of apparel consisting of a strap worn over the shoulder and used hold up trousers. Called braces in other parts of the world.
suspender (Noun)
An item of apparel used to hold up a sock or (now especially) a stocking, such as a garter, or each of the fastening-straps attached to a corset or suspender belt.
